Automatic Merging
The conversion script will merge current releases into release groups if:
- they are linked with the earliest release AR and have the same type or
- they are linked with the translation/transliteration AR or
- they are linked with the part of set AR or
- they are linked with the remaster AR and have the same type or
- they share the same Discogs URL or
- they share the same Wikipedia URL or
- they share the same Amazon URL or
- they have the same release event with all fields except barcode filled in
- they have release event with all fields filled in and all fields except the catalog number are the same
Counter examples (Example of bad results)
- they have release event with all fields filled in and all fields except the catalog number are the same
- These EPs have been release separately, but also in a boxset: Mathematics & With the Invisible. Because of the common release event (for the boxset) their release-group is going to be merged, which is wrong.
- they share the same Amazon URL
- http://musicbrainz.org/show/url/?urlid=430700 is going wronly merge all the 3 linked releases. While this one can be fixed now, there are probably others that won't be fixed before the automatic merge.
- this release has a shared ASIN, a PartOfSetRelationship and a EarliestReleaseRelationship. Because of this shared ASIN all the linked releases will see their release-groups merged.
